Old Boots left this review about The Stanley Jefferson (JD Wetherspoon)

A standard town ‘spoons in a nice old building, split down the middle reflecting the former layout. Drinking area with counter to the left, 5 plus 5 pulls with usual stuff on T-Bars in between. The other side is a series of spaces with tables and chairs. Stanley Jefferson is Stan Laurel’s real name and he went to school in Bishop Auckland so there’s a bit of Laurel & Hardy memorabilia among the usual local history plaques. A nice enough spoons, average beer but it is one of a very limited number of cask outlets in Bishop Auckland.

Aqualung . left this review about The Stanley Jefferson (JD Wetherspoon)

This is a conversion of a former solicitor's office which makes it more pub like than the High Street shop or office conversions. It's situated on the cobbled Market Place and as JDWs go is probably best described as medium sized.
Inside it's split into various areas with some low beams and the bar situated at the rear left. There was a fair crowd in on my Thursday afternoon visit.
The bar has only eight hand pumps which had one unused, the two GK beers, Grafton Apricot Jungle, Firebrick Trade Star, Saltaire Cascadian Black, Spitfire and Nelson's Mutineer. I went for the Cascadian Black which was excellent.
Overall I thought this was a good Spoons.
